What CSauna checks before CSA-375 is quoted
CSA-375 should lead with cold-climate planning rather than simply saying weatherproof.
Cold climate use changes heater power, glass area, warm-up time, door sealing, and maintenance notes.
The buyer should state whether the sauna is for backyard, resort, mountain cabin, or rental site.
Large glass may look better but can increase warm-up time in winter conditions.
Roof and base protection should be approved before production because snow and drainage affect service life.
CSauna should photograph roof pack, base detail, heater label, glass protection, and exterior panel marks.
The quote should separate structure, heater, roof, glass, packing, labels, documents, and spare parts.

Project handoff note
For cold-climate projects, the buyer should confirm snow exposure, winter temperature range, expected warm-up time, glass area, roof runoff direction, and base protection before the heater is selected. CSauna records these points with packing photos so the order file explains why heater power, roof parts, and spare trim were chosen.
